Product Overview
Conductive Polymer Hybrid Aluminum Electrolytic Capacitors offering high ripple current and large capacitance compared to ZC series. These capacitors provide an endurance of 4000 hours at 125 and exhibit minimal characteristic changes with temperature and frequency, similar to conductive polymer types. Vibration-proof options are available upon request. They are AEC-Q200 compliant and RoHS compliant, suitable for applications requiring high reliability.

Technical Specifications
| Series | Type | Rated Voltage (V.DC) | Capacitance (F) | Size Code | Case Size (mm) L x D | ESR*2 (m) (100 kHz / +20 ) | Ripple Current*1 (mA r.m.s.) (100 kHz / +125 ) | tan *3 (120 Hz / +20 ) | Endurance (h) | Part Number (Standard) | Part Number (Vibration-proof) |
|---|---|---|---|---|---|---|---|---|---|---|---|
| ZS | V | 25 | 150 | G16 | 16.5 x 10.0 | 0.15 | 250 | 0.25 | 4000 | EEHZS1E151V | EEHZS1E151P |
| ZS | V | 25 | 220 | G16 | 16.5 x 10.0 | 0.12 | 250 | 0.25 | 4000 | EEHZS1E221V | EEHZS1E221P |
| ZS | V | 35 | 470 | G16 | 16.5 x 10.0 | 0.10 | 250 | 0.20 | 4000 | EEHZS1V471V | EEHZS1V471P |
| ZS | V | 50 | 560 | G16 | 16.5 x 10.0 | 0.08 | 250 | 0.15 | 4000 | EEHZS1H561V | EEHZS1H561P |
| ZS | V | 63 | 150 | G16 | 16.5 x 10.0 | 0.15 | 250 | 0.25 | 4000 | EEHZS1J151V | EEHZS1J151P |
